ALERT: Some images may not load properly within the Knowledge Base Article. If you see a broken image, please right-click and select 'Open image in a new tab'. We apologize for this inconvenience.
"Failed to update properties on the Jaspersoft server. Exception getting ClarityJasperAdmin : Unauthorized access to http://testserver:8080/reportservice with username ppmjasperadmin".
How to recreate / regenerate the Jaspersoft keystore?
Environment
Release : All Supported Clarity releases
Component : CLARITY JASPERSOFT
Resolution
Go to the CLARITY_INSTALL/bin folder and enter the command: admin jaspersoft keystore
This will generate the following files in the CLARITY_INSTALL/config folder:
<orgname>.jks (key store file)
<orgname>.properties (information about the key)
Copy the two generated files to the Tomcat for Jaspersoft folder: TOMCAT_JASPERSOFT/webapps/reportservice/WEB-INF/config
Copy to all other servers in <Clarity>/META-INF/reporting/store
Restart Jaspersoft
Try to run Create Jaspersoft users job from Clarity.